The Foundation of a Real Food Diet:
✔ Fresh Organic Vegetables and Fruits – Eat a variety of colorful, nutrient-rich produce.
✔ Grass-Fed, Pasture-Raised Meats – Choose high-quality animal protein from ethical sources.
✔ Wild-Caught Fish – Prioritize fish rich in omega-3s like salmon and sardines.
✔ Healthy Fats – Avocados, coconut oil, extra virgin olive oil, and grass-fed butter.
✔ Nuts and Seeds – Raw almonds, walnuts, chia seeds, flaxseeds, and hemp seeds.
✔ Fermented Foods – Sauerkraut, kimchi, kefir, and probiotic-rich foods for gut health.
✔ Ancient Grains and Legumes (if tolerated) – Quinoa, lentils, chickpeas, and wild rice.

The Grocery Store Survival Guide
Tips for Navigating the Supermarket Safely:
✔ Shop the perimeter – The healthiest foods (fresh produce, meat, fish, dairy) are usually along the outer edges of the store.
✔ Read ingredient labels carefully – If you can’t pronounce an ingredient or don’t recognize it as food, avoid it.
✔ Avoid anything with added sugar, artificial flavors, or preservatives – These are red flags for processed food.
✔ Buy organic when possible – Especially for produce that is part of the Dirty Dozen list (high in pesticides).
✔ Choose whole, single-ingredient foods – The best foods don’t come with ingredient lists (think vegetables, eggs, or nuts).
